With PXC 45 just 24 hours away, the cast of 16 fighters, all made weight Thursday afternoon and are ready for Friday evening’s big event.

The PXC bantamweight belt will be on the line as Kyle “Money” Aguon will square off against the Philippines Rolando Dy to headline the event. Dy weighed in slightly over the designated mark at 135.5 and was instructed to lose half a lb. in the next two hours.

Doors will open at 5:30 PM and the first fight of the night will start at 7:30PM.

Here are the complete weights for all of Friday’s bouts:

Kyle Aguon (134.4) vs Rolando Dy (135.5) *PXC bantamweight championship fight

Brogan Walker (124.2) vs Yoojin Jung (125.9) *female flyweight fight

Kyle Reyes (144) vs Alex Volkanovski (145.9) *featherweight fight

Trevin Jones (134.4) vs Toby Misech (136) *bantamweight fight

Darren Uyenoyama (125.7) vs Shane Alvarez (125.7) *flyweight fight

Tyrone Jones (153.9) vs Hong Seung Chan (155) *lightweight fight

Scotty Eclavea (124) vs Mike Sanchez (125) *flyweight fight

McKlane Alfred (125) vs Vince Masga (124.9) *flyweight fight
